Unable to revise a listing due to pending offers, but there are no pending offers

Offers can either be those sent by buyers or offers you sent to watchers. If YOU sent offers those offers remain PENDING  for 96 hours during that time you will not be able to revise anything in those listings. Same goes for offers sent by buyers.  If you want to revise you either have to wait for your offers to expire or end the listing and relist.
